History - net.minecraft.world.entity.ai.behavior.LongJumpToPreferredBlock
1.21.3
Names
bwj
bzb
Fields
TagKey<Block>: m, preferredBlockTag, field_37427, favoredBlocks, f_217259_
TagKey<Block>: m, preferredBlockTag, field_37427, favoredBlocks
float: n, preferredBlocksChance, field_37428, biasChance, f_217260_
float: n, preferredBlocksChance, field_37428, biasChance
List<LongJumpToRandomPos$PossibleJump>: o, notPrefferedJumpCandidates, field_37429, unfavoredTargets, f_217261_
List<LongJumpToRandomPos$PossibleJump>: o, notPrefferedJumpCandidates, field_37429, unfavoredTargets
boolean: p, currentlyWantingPreferredOnes, field_37430, useBias, f_217262_
boolean: p, currentlyWantingPreferredOnes, field_37430, useBias
Constructors
Methods
void (ServerLevel, E, long): a, start, method_35082, run, m_6735_
void (ServerLevel, E, long): a, start, method_35082, run
Optional<LongJumpToRandomPos$PossibleJump> (ServerLevel): a, getJumpCandidate, method_41336, getTarget, m_213675_
Optional<LongJumpToRandomPos$PossibleJump> (ServerLevel): a, getJumpCandidate, method_41336, removeRandomTarget
1.21.1
Names
Fields
Constructors
Methods
1.21
Names
bwm
bwj
Fields
Constructors
Methods
1.20.6
Names
bpe
bwm
Fields
Constructors
Methods
1.20.4
Names
blz
bpe
Fields
Constructors
Methods
1.20.2
Names
bit
blz
Fields
Constructors
Methods
1.20.1
Names
bir
bit
Fields
Constructors
Methods
1.19.4
Names
bgw
bir
Fields
Constructors
Methods
1.19.3
Names
bes
bgw
Fields
Constructors
(UniformInt, int, int, float, Function<E, SoundEvent>, TagKey<Block>, float, Predicate<BlockState>)
(UniformInt, int, int, float, Function<E, SoundEvent>, TagKey<Block>, float, BiPredicate<E, BlockPos>)
Methods
boolean (ServerLevel, E, BlockPos): a, isAcceptableLandingPosition, method_41337, canJumpTo, m_213828_
boolean (ServerLevel, BlockPos): a, willNotLandInFluid, method_41338, isFluidStateAndBelowEmpty, m_217286_
1.19.2
Names
Fields
Constructors
Methods
1.19.1
Names
bdv
bes
Fields
Constructors
Methods
1.19
Names
bdv
net.minecraft.world.entity.ai.behavior.LongJumpToPreferredBlock
net.minecraft.class_7096
net.minecraft.entity.ai.brain.task.BiasedLongJumpTask
net.minecraft.src.C_213014_
net.minecraft.world.entity.ai.behavior.LongJumpToPreferredBlock
Fields
TagKey<Block>: m, preferredBlockTag, field_37427, favoredBlocks, f_217259_
float: n, preferredBlocksChance, field_37428, biasChance, f_217260_
List<LongJumpToRandomPos$PossibleJump>: o, notPrefferedJumpCandidates, field_37429, unfavoredTargets, f_217261_
boolean: p, currentlyWantingPreferredOnes, field_37430, useBias, f_217262_
Constructors
(UniformInt, int, int, float, Function<E, SoundEvent>, TagKey<Block>, float, Predicate<BlockState>)
Methods
void (ServerLevel, E, long): a, start, method_35082, run, m_6735_
Optional<LongJumpToRandomPos$PossibleJump> (ServerLevel): a, getJumpCandidate, method_41336, getTarget, m_213675_
boolean (ServerLevel, E, BlockPos): a, isAcceptableLandingPosition, method_41337, canJumpTo, m_213828_
boolean (ServerLevel, BlockPos): a, willNotLandInFluid, method_41338, isFluidStateAndBelowEmpty, m_217286_